Lady M @ Jewel Changi Airport

Cake shop · Changi Airport

"Lady M® New York is the pioneer of the well-loved Mille Crêpes. The Signature Mille Crêpes features no less than twenty paper-thin handmade crêpes layered with ethereal light pastry cream, gently caramelized on top until golden. Combining French pastry techniques with Japanese etiquette of precision, Lady M New York prides itself on creating the freshest and finest cakes and confectionary delights. Since opening its first 600 square feet cake boutique in New York's Upper East Side in 2001, Lady M New York has assembled a phenomenal little black book of fans state-side, from the likes of domestic goddess Martha Stewart, to Supermodel Linda Evangelista and Japanese fashion designer, Issey Miyake."

Shashlik Restaurant

Russian restaurant · Boulevard

"Our Russo-Hainanese heritage was born from the legendary Troika Restaurant in 1963, where Hainanese chefs first interpreted the timeless recipes of Russian Chef, Mamochka Liber. When Troika’s golden era ended in January 1986, nine former employees pooled their life savings together and opened Shashlik Restaurant in April 1986, an ode to their Russo-Hainanese culinary heritage. Their passion for food and genuine appreciation for every diner quickly established the Shashlik Ah Kors as stalwarts on the local dining scene. Our old-school restaurant is also known for its geriatric Hainanese waiters and chefs. With a rich 30 years heritage, the restaurant has been serving generations of loyal diners from all over the world."
